AMIT 135: Lesson 7 Ball Mills & Circuits

φB = density of ball media Charge Height Measurement of charge height is a convenient method to estimate charge volume. Generally : For overflow ball mills, the charge should not exceed 45% of the mill volume . For grate discharge mills, the charge should occupy about 50% of the mill volume .

Bond Index Ball Mill / Rod Mill BT 100 XL - RETSCH

The Bond Index conforming rod charge consists of: 6 rods of 1.25" diameter and 21" length. 2 rods of 1.75" diameter and 21" length. The grinding jar for the Bond Index Rod Mill is 12″ x 24″ in size and has a wave-shaped design. At least 15 to 20 kg sample material is required to simulate a closed grinding circuit in a ball or rod mill.

Bond Work Index Tests | GSL - Grinding Solutions Ltd

The Bond Ball Mill Work Index (BBWi) test is carried out in a standardised ball mill with a pre-defined media and ore charge. The Work Index calculated from the testing can be used in the design and analysis of ball mill circuits. The test requires a minimum of 10kg of sample that has been stage-crushed to 100% passing size of <3.35 mm.

Cement Grinding - Cement Plant Optimization

Water Spray in Cement Mills. Water spray installed generally in second compartment of ball mill to control cement temperature. Cement discharge temperature should be kept below about 110 o C but, the same time should allow some 60% dehydration of gypsum to optimize cement strength without excessive false set.

Understanding Grinding Wheel Hardness - Sparky Abrasives

The amount of abrasive bond in the grinding wheel determines its grade or hardness. Hardness is dependent on the grit type, the material being ground, the amount of stock removed, and a number of other factors.
